I absolutely love Bright Breaks! Since it launched at our company, I’ve really enjoyed both the live and on-demand sessions available every day. The variety is amazing, and I always look forward to seeing the different instructors. These short breaks have become a highlight of my day, and they’ve really helped me get up and move more often.
What I also love is how easy the site and app are to use and navigate. One of my favorite features is the sync with my calendar, so it only shows me breaks that fit into my schedule. It makes it so much easier to jump into a break without having to search for one. I’m always amazed at how just a few minutes can get my heart rate up or teach me something new.
It’s such a great program, and I genuinely look forward to it every day. Bright Breaks has definitely made my workday more fun and active! Review collected by and hosted on G2.com.
I’m really enjoying the variety of sessions offered on Bright Breaks, especially the barre sessions! One suggestion I have is for the site to recommend similar types of breaks based on what I’ve enjoyed. For example, since I like the barre sessions, it would be great to see suggestions for other kinds of dance-based Move Breaks that I might also like. This would help me explore new activities while still staying in the category of exercises I enjoy.
Overall, I love the platform and think this feature would make it even better! Review collected by and hosted on G2.com.

It's a service that actually works! Bright Breaks makes it fun and easy to ensure I actually take small breaks in my day. I like the variety of breaks. I have taken everything from pilates and cardio to stretching and yoga. I love to take the live breaks, where you are watching an instructor and joining along with other people. Super easy and fun, and it's motivating to earn points and apply them to challenges where you can win good prizes ($50 Starbucks gift cards, etc.). Review collected by and hosted on G2.com.
I wish they would announce the winners of the challenges. Even if it's just posting the first name and last initial. I sign up for every challenge but it feels anticlimactic when I have to just assume I didn't win and I don't know how it ends. Review collected by and hosted on G2.com.
